
One of our newest scratch games has prompted comments from some players who thought they should be able to win with a different symbol on their tickets than the actual winning symbols.
The bottom-line answer is that only the winning symbols will bring you a prize in the game. But here’s the full background involved:
The players’ comments have been about the “Joker’s Wild” scratch game that just hit the market this month. There are 15 prize spots in the play area on each Joker’s Wild ticket, and you scratch them off to see if you’ve won.
As its name indicates, Joker’s Wild has a card-game theme. If you uncover the joker card in one of the prize spots on your ticket, you’ll win the prize shown for that spot.
If you uncover the cherry card, you’ll win 10X the prize shown. And if you uncover the money bag card, you’ll win all 15 prizes on your ticket.
The amount you can win on a ticket ranges from $5 up to $50,000.
What Some Players Are Saying
Each of the symbols in the play area on a Joker’s Wild ticket is identified with both an image and letters underneath it. For example, the queen card shows both the Q symbol and the identifying letters of QUN. The three card has the numeral 3 with the letters THR, and so on.
The players’ questions have been about the seven card (7-SVN) and the cherry card (cherry symbol + 10X). Those are highlighted in the image of a Joker’s Wild ticket you can see here.
The players have said they think the cherry symbol looks a bit like a numeral 7 and therefore, they should be able to win a prize with the 7 card their ticket.
But even if you think that the cherry symbol looks like the number 7, the cherry card also has the 10X identifier on it. The 7-SVN card does not.
The 7-SVN card is not a winning symbol in the game. So no, you won’t win a prize with that card on your ticket.
